Our Admissions & Referral Process

Rivendell of Arkansas has staff dedicated to walking patients and referring individuals through the entire admissions process, including scheduling a no-cost, in-person assessment at our facility or select locations in the community (schools, community centers, courts, etc.). Our Mobile Assessment and Emergency Response Teams are trained and ready to respond to your specific needs and present the resources/options available.

Our 30 to 60-minute assessments are done under the direction of clinical and medical leaders with a physician available by telephone to discuss any specific issues as necessary. Once admitted, a physician will conduct a psychiatric evaluation of the patient taking into consideration social influences and stressors, education and physical health. The admitting physician will initiate a diagnosis in an emergent situation to stabilize any acute symptoms and continue assessing the patient for further psychiatric conditions throughout treatment.

Referrals

Referrals can be made by an individual patient, or family or loved one being affected by an individual patient’s crisis. Members of the professional community (physicians, courts, counseling/community agencies, psychologists, etc.) can also refer individuals to our facility for treatment and assessment.
